Duo uses dating website to reel in robbery victim: NOPD
NOLA.com | The Times-Picayune ^ | 2/4/17 | Laura McKnight, NOLA.com | The Times-Picayune

Posted on 02/04/2017 12:23:46 PM PST by BBell

A 21-year-old man and 17-year-old woman are accused of using the dating website Plenty Of Fish to lure a man to a St. Roch park and then rob him at gunpoint, according to New Orleans police.

Jarius Smith and Oliska McNeil were arrested and booked into the Orleans Justice Center jail Wednesday (Feb. 1) with armed robbery.

Detectives continue investigating to see if the duo has been involved in similar cases reported in the NOPD's 7th District, which includes a large swath of New Orleans East.

The pair is charged in a robbery that occurred nearly two weeks ago, according to the NOPD. In that robbery, the victim arrived to St. Roch Park around 11:35 p.m. Jan. 21 to meet McNeil whom he had met on the Plenty Of Fish website.

McNeil approached the victim's vehicle with Smith, whom she introduced as her cousin. She then asked the victim if he could drop her cousin off at a nearby location, the NOPD said.
